West Englewood rental market summary

The rental market in West Englewood, Illinois is showing signs of growth. In July 2023, there were 56 new listings, indicating that more people are looking to rent in the area. The median rent for the month of July 2023 was $1,300, which is the same as the median rent in June 2023. This suggests that the rental market is stable and not seeing any major fluctuations in prices. However, when compared to the median rent in July 2022, there has been an increase of 23.8%. This indicates that the rental market in West Englewood is growing and becoming more expensive.

West Englewood neighborhood apartments rents

The rental market for studios in West Englewood, Illinois appears to be relatively stable, with only one new listing in April 2023 and a median rent of $800. The rental market for 1-bedroom apartments in West Englewood, Illinois appears to be stable, with only one new listing in April 2023 and a median rent of $800. The rental market for 2-bedroom apartments in West Englewood, Illinois appears to be relatively stable, with only two new listings in April 2023 and a median rent of $1,050.
